About the clinic

American Hospital Pristina (often referenced as American Hospital Kosova) is a private hospital in Pristina. The clinic is positioned within a wider “American Hospital” network in the region and as a facility built around modern diagnostics, multidisciplinary care, and international-style clinical workflows. The hospital is presented as a 24/7 provider with continuous availability across acute and elective care, combining specialist physician services with supporting infrastructure such as laboratory medicine, imaging, and pathology to enable end-to-end workups and treatment planning in a single setting. Its laboratory services (clinical biochemistry, microbiology, and pathology) support prevention and diagnosis as well as structured protocols for cardiac patients before coronary angiography, oncology patients before chemotherapy, and perioperative monitoring for cardiac, general, orthopaedic, and other surgical cases. As a reference centre for major surgical procedures, the hospital places particular emphasis on immunohistopathology, combining conventional biopsy evaluation with advanced frozen-section diagnostics to support accurate therapy planning and enable the most conservative surgery whenever possible. Around-the-clock advanced imaging is another core capability, delivered by radiologists and specialized technicians using modern digital and 3D technologies, with reporting typically completed within hours; services include CT (including cardiac CT), PET-CT, MRI, scintigraphy, digital mammography, bone densitometry, ultrasound/Doppler, and digital X-ray. The hospital offers comprehensive cardiology care from prevention and emergency management to invasive treatment, including ECG and echocardiography, stress testing and Holter monitoring, coronary angiography, stent implantation, pacemakers, electrophysiological studies, and ablation. Surgical capacity spans cardiovascular, vascular, thoracic, general and oncologic surgery, with procedures ranging from bypass and valve surgery to aortic and carotid interventions, lung and pleural surgery (including minimally invasive VATS), and a broad spectrum of abdominal, endoscopic, bariatric, and hernia operations, supported by close collaboration across gastroenterology, oncology, urology, gynecology, pathology, and imaging. Women’s health services cover gynecologic and obstetric care, gynecologic oncology, high-risk pregnancy monitoring, and infertility treatment, including IVF, supported by an advanced embryology laboratory. Urology and orthopedics emphasize minimally invasive and laparoscopic approaches, including contemporary kidney stone treatments, tumor and prostate surgery, trauma and polytrauma care, arthroscopy, reconstructive procedures, and pediatric cases. The hospital also provides plastic and reconstructive surgery, ENT care supported by endoscopic and microscopic technologies, and neurosurgical treatment for cranial and spinal conditions, creating an integrated environment where diagnostics, intervention, and follow-up are coordinated under one structure.
